WebSep 26, 2024 · Step 1. Define your think tank's purpose, focus and audience. For example, the U.S.-based Center for Strategic and International Studies says its purpose is "finding ways to sustain American prominence and prosperity" through new governmental policy. The audience it directly benefits is the U.S. government.
